The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) has invited former Attorney-General of the Federation and Minister of Justice, Abubakar Malami, for questioning.

Malami, who served from 2015 to 2023 under former President Muhammadu Buhari, confirmed the invitation on his Facebook page, stating he will honour it as a law-abiding citizen.
